The Bishop of Ely is the senior spiritual leader of the Diocese of Ely, providing oversight, guidance, and pastoral support to clergy, parishes, and church communities across Cambridgeshire, West Norfolk, and parts of Peterborough. As a key figure in the Church of England, the Bishop contributes to national church leadership, and works in partnership with civic, educational, and ecumenical bodies to promote the mission of the Church in public life.
The Right Reverend Stephen Conway was confirmed as the 69th Bishop of Ely on 6th December, 2010. He was installed in Ely Cathedral on Saturday, 5th March, 2011. Bishop Stephen announced he will be leaving the Diocese of Ely to become Bishop of Lincoln in May 2023, and gave his final Sermon as Bishop of Ely on 16th July 2023.
